How to use college pages without confusion

Use the college section when you are researching vocational routes, adult learning, technical study, or local higher-education options that are not traditional universities.

Open the official college website quickly if the exact qualification route matters, because colleges often separate apprenticeships, FE, and HE routes clearly in navigation.

Compare colleges by local area and practical fit, not just by name. Location and delivery model often matter more here than national prestige signals.

Common mistakes

  • Assuming every college page is meant to answer university-style search intent.
  • Not checking whether the route is FE, apprenticeship, adult learning, or higher education.
  • Ignoring local travel, timetable fit, and commuter practicality.

What is a further education college in the UK?

A further education college usually focuses on vocational study, adult learning, apprenticeships, and some higher-education routes, rather than the broader degree-led identity of a university.

Can a college still offer higher-education courses?

Yes. Some colleges offer HNCs, HNDs, foundation degrees, or other higher-education routes, but that does not make them the same kind of page target as a university.
